Book reviews for kids fairy tale7/11/2023 ![]() ![]() ![]() In other words, it is for this very reason that he, instead of his brother, is chosen to be adopted secretly as the heir to Pashupati, who deals illegally in human bones, skeletons and kidneys, runs a blood farm, cooks and eats the livers of newborn babies to prolong his youth, sells beggar children into adoption, and uses as his alarm clock a string of women whose job it is to fellate him into awakening at the crowing hour of the rooster. Nirip is blessed with one missing kidney at birth, a fate that ironically results in him becoming the “impotent prince of a bloody rotten world". The twist of fate that has separated them is a kidney. “You must tell me your past, all of it," Nirip tells Anguli, “so that we can then decide what to do about the future." It’s that age when one examines just how one’s precious life has been spent, and what that may mean, if anything, for one’s future. The twins in this case, Anguli and Nirip, meet just as their 50th birthday approaches. Chatterjee’s is a “separated at birth" story.
